RECHARGEABLE BATTERY WITH MULTI-LAYER MEMBRANE

    Abstract: Batteries are described that include a cathode, an anode, and a separator that electrically insulates the cathode from the anode. The separator includes a cation exchange membrane positioned between a first anion exchange membrane and a second anion exchange membrane, and has a hydroxide ion conductivity of at least about 10 mS/cm, and a diffusion ratio of hydroxide ions to at least one type of metal ion of at least about 100:1. Also described are methods of making a battery that include forming a separator between a cathode electrode and an anode electrode. The separator includes a cation exchange membrane positioned between a first anion exchange membrane and a second anion exchange membrane. The methods also include contacting the cathode electrode with a cathode current collector and the anode electrode with an anode current collector, where the cathode and anode currently collectors are electrically insulated from each other by a spacer material.

    RECHARGEABLE BATTERY WITH HYDROGEN SCAVENGER

    Abstract: Energy storage devices, battery cells, and batteries of the present technology may include a first current collector and a second current collector. The batteries may include an anode material coupled with the first current collector. The batteries may include a cathode material coupled with the second current collector. The batteries may also include a separator positioned between the cathode material and the anode material. The batteries may include a hydrogen-scavenger material incorporated within the anode active material or the cathode active material. The hydrogen scavenger material may absorb or react with hydrogen at a temperature above or about 20° C.

    RECHARGEABLE BATTERY WITH ANION CONDUCTING POLYMER

    Abstract: Batteries are described that include a cathode material, and anode material, and a polymeric material that separates the cathode material from the anode material. The polymeric material has hydroxide ion conductivity of at least about 50 mS/cm, and a diffusion ration of hydroxide ions to at least one type of metal ion of at least about 10:1. Also described are methods of making a battery that include forming a layer of polymeric material between a first electrode and second electrode of the battery. In additional methods, the polymeric material is coated on at least one of the electrodes of the battery. In further methods, the polymeric material is admixed with at least one of the electrode materials to make a composite electrode material that is incorporated into the electrode.
